local lspconfig = require "lspconfig"
local servers = {
-- Language servers for the day to day web development, could probably think
-- about loosing the html and css one and living with typescript, rescript
-- and emmet
tsserver = {},
rescriptls = {
cmd = {
os.getenv "NVM_BIN" .. "/node",
os.getenv "HOME" .. "/.config/nvim/pack/bundle/start/vim-rescript/server/out/server.js",
"--stdio",
},
},
html = {},
cssls = {},
emmet_ls = {
filetypes = { "html", "typescriptreact", "javascriptreact", "css", "scss", "eruby" },
},
-- Ruby
solargraph = {},
-- Rust
rust_analyzer = {},
-- Lua for the vim config and plugin dev
sumneko_lua = {
settings = {
Lua = {
runtime = { version = "LuaJIT" },
diagnostics = { globals = { "vim" } },
workspace = { library = vim.api.nvim_get_runtime_file("", true) },
telemetry = { enable = false },
},
},
},
}
local on_attach = function(_, bufnr)
vim.api.nvim_buf_set_option(bufnr, "omnifunc", "v:lua.vim.lsp.omnifunc")
local opts = { noremap = true, silent = true }
-- Mappings.
-- See `:help vim.lsp.*` for documentation on any of the below functions
vim.api.nvim_buf_set_keymap(bufnr, "n", "gD", "<cmd>lua vim.lsp.buf.declaration()<CR>", opts)
vim.api.nvim_buf_set_keymap(bufnr, "n", "gd", "<cmd>lua vim.lsp.buf.definition()<CR>", opts)
vim.api.nvim_buf_set_keymap(bufnr, "n", "K", "<cmd>lua vim.lsp.buf.hover()<CR>", opts)
vim.api.nvim_buf_set_keymap(bufnr, "n", "gi", "<cmd>lua vim.lsp.buf.implementation()<CR>", opts)
vim.api.nvim_buf_set_keymap(bufnr, "n", "gr", "<cmd>lua vim.lsp.buf.references()<CR>", opts)
vim.api.nvim_buf_set_keymap(bufnr, "n", "<leader>rn", "<cmd>lua vim.lsp.buf.rename()<CR>", opts)
vim.api.nvim_buf_set_keymap(bufnr, "n", "<leader>ca", "<cmd>lua vim.lsp.buf.code_action()<CR>", opts)
end
local capabilities = require("cmp_nvim_lsp").update_capabilities(vim.lsp.protocol.make_client_capabilities())
capabilities.textDocument.completion.completionItem.snippetSupport = true
for lsp, config in pairs(servers) do
config["on_attach"] = on_attach
config["capabilities"] = capabilities
config["init_options"] = { usePlaceholders = true }
lspconfig[lsp].setup(config)
end
-- Change the diagnostic signs
vim.fn.sign_define("DiagnosticSignHint", { text = "", texthl = "DiagnosticSignHint", numhl = "DiagnosticSignHint" })
vim.fn.sign_define("DiagnosticSignInfo", { text = "", texthl = "DiagnosticSignInfo", numhl = "DiagnosticSignInfo" })
vim.fn.sign_define("DiagnosticSignWarn", { text = "", texthl = "DiagnosticSignWarn", numhl = "DiagnosticSignWarn" })
vim.fn.sign_define(
"DiagnosticSignError",
{ text = "", texthl = "DiagnosticSignError", numhl = "DiagnosticSignError" }
)
local border = 'rounded'
vim.lsp.handlers["textDocument/hover"] = vim.lsp.with(vim.lsp.handlers.hover, {border = border})
vim.lsp.handlers["textDocument/show_line_diagnostics"] = vim.lsp.with(vim.lsp.handlers.hover, {border = border})
vim.lsp.handlers["textDocument/diagnostic"] = vim.lsp.with(vim.lsp.handlers.hover, {border = border})
vim.lsp.handlers["textDocument/diagnostics"] = vim.lsp.with(vim.lsp.handlers.hover, {border = border})
vim.diagnostic.config({
float = {
focusable=false,
border = border
}
})
